Common Reflectix Insulation Problems We Solve in Minneapolis

  • Foil delamination from condensation cycling. Minneapolis attics see warm interior air hit cold roof decking all winter. Over time, Reflectix foil facing separates from the bubble core, especially in under-ventilated attics on pre-1940 homes. We see this most in Longfellow and Nokomis bungalows where original ventilation was never upgraded.
  • Sagging and torn radiant barriers. Stapled Reflectix radiant barrier pulls away from rafters when open balloon-frame wall top plates let snowmelt drip back down and re-freeze on the foil surface. The weight of frost followed by thaw cycles eventually tears the foil at the staple points.
  • Installed without an air gap. Reflectix only delivers its stated R-value with a 3/4-inch vented space. Homeowners in Minneapolis remodels often staple it flat against roof decking, then call us when ice dams keep forming despite the new foil. This is the single most common Reflectix mistake we correct.
  • Rodent damage in rim joists. Reflectix foil in uninsulated Minneapolis basement rim cavities gets punctured by rodent chew-through. Pre-1940 houses with unsealed rim cavities and mature tree cover nearby account for most of these calls, particularly in North and Northeast Minneapolis.
  • Foil masking bypasses instead of fixing them. The roof looks insulated, snow still melts unevenly, and the ice dam returns. The foil isn’t the problem so much as what’s happening behind it.

Reflectix Service in Minneapolis: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ment

Here’s something you won’t read on a generic Reflectix page. South Minneapolis balloon-frame bungalows have what we call the attic bypass triangle: open wall top plates, interior partition walls open to the attic, and unsealed chimney chases. Together these dump conditioned air above any foil barrier regardless of how much insulation sits below it. Last February our crew worked on a 1922 craftsman bungalow on 38th Avenue South in Longfellow where the homeowner had stapled Reflectix Double Reflective Insulation directly to the underside of the rafters in their attic insulation - Minneapolis project. After the first heavy snowfall, thermal imaging showed the bypass triangle still pumping heat above the foil, and the roof had an ice dam wider than the eaves. We removed the sagging Reflectix, sealed the top plates and chimney chase with closed-cell foam, then reinstalled a new radiant barrier with the required 3/4-inch air gap. The next snowfall left the roof cold and clear. Neighboring suburbs with 1970s platform-frame ranch homes almost never see this failure at the same frequency, which is why Minneapolis Reflectix work demands a local eye.

Why did my Reflectix radiant barrier not stop ice dams on my Minneapolis bungalow? Because in balloon-framed Minneapolis homes, open wall top plates, partition walls, and chimney chases dump warm air above the foil, melting snow that refreezes at the eaves. Can Reflectix bubble insulation be used alone to hit Minneapolis R-49 attic code? No. Reflectix bubble insulation delivers roughly R-1 to R-6 depending on installation and air gap, far short of Minnesota’s Zone 6 attic minimum of R-49 to R-60. It can supplement fiberglass or cellulose as a radiant barrier, but it cannot serve as the primary attic insulation in Minneapolis.

Should I install Reflectix in my crawl space floor in Minneapolis? In most Minneapolis crawl spaces, a vapor barrier on the ground and sealing the rim joists matters far more than reflective foil under the floor. Reflectix can work as a rim joist cover if installed with an air gap and rodent protection, but we often recommend closed-cell foam for the rim in pre-1940 Minneapolis homes where unsealed cavities are common.

How do I know if my existing Reflectix attic foil is installed right? Check for a consistent 3/4-inch air gap between the foil and the roof decking, tight staple points with no sagging, and no frost or condensation on the foil surface after cold nights. Is Reflectix worth installing in a Minneapolis attic with blown-in cellulose already at R-60? If the attic is already properly air-sealed and at R-60, adding Reflectix radiant barrier provides marginal benefit in Minneapolis where heating dominates and the roof deck stays cold most of the year. Your money is usually better spent addressing bypasses or upgrading ventilation. We’ll tell you straight if foil won’t pay off.
